** The bathroom remodeling market in the Sacramento, PA, area is characterized by a reliance on established, local and regional contractors from larger nearby towns like Pottsville. The competition is moderate, with a mix of specialized plumbing/remodeling firms, national franchise providers, and skilled general contractors. The average quality is high, as these businesses rely heavily on local reputation and word-of-mouth referrals. Homeowners can expect personalized service but may need to plan for scheduling lead times, especially for the most in-demand contractors.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in this region is competitive compared to major metropolitan areas. A mid-range full renovation can range from **$12,000 - $25,000**, while high-end projects with custom tile, layout changes, and accessibility features can easily exceed **$35,000**. Smaller projects like a shower replacement or vanity installation typically range from **$3,500 - $8,000**. It is always recommended to obtain multiple detailed quotes for any project.

In the Sacramento and broader Schuylkill County region, a full bathroom remodel typically ranges from $15,000 to $35,000+, depending on the size of the bathroom, material selections, and scope of work. Regional labor and material costs are generally moderate, but factors like the age of your home (common in this historic area) can uncover unexpected structural issues, so it's wise to include a 10-15% contingency in your budget. High-end customizations with features like heated floors or custom tilework will push costs toward the higher end of that spectrum.
Sacramento's humid summers and cold winters make proper ventilation and moisture-resistant materials critical. We strongly recommend installing a high-CFM exhaust fan vented directly outside to combat mold and mildew. For flooring and walls, porcelain tile is an excellent local choice due to its durability and resistance to temperature/humidity swings. Additionally, considering supplemental heat sources like radiant floor heating or a dedicated heater can make the bathroom more comfortable during our harsh Pennsylvania winters.
Yes, most structural, plumbing, and electrical work in Sacramento Borough will require permits from your local municipal office. Pennsylvania's Uniform Construction Code (UCC) is enforced locally, and specific rules apply to waterproofing, electrical outlets near water sources, and proper venting. A reputable local contractor will handle this process, but it's your responsibility as the homeowner to verify that permits are pulled and inspections are scheduled to ensure your project is safe, legal, and up to code.
While interior remodels can be done year-round, late spring through early fall is often ideal in Sacramento, as contractors are more readily available and materials can be delivered without winter weather delays. A typical full remodel takes 3 to 6 weeks from demolition to completion. Scheduling in advance is key, especially if you want to complete the project before the holiday season, as local contractor schedules can fill up quickly.
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have a verifiable physical address in Pennsylvania. Ask for local references and photos of completed projects in Schuylkill County, as they will understand the nuances of working with older home foundations and plumbing common here. Always check their standing with the PA Attorney General's Bureau of Consumer Protection and ensure they provide a detailed, written contract that outlines the project scope, timeline, payment schedule, and warranty.
